Abstract
The corrosion behaviour of a AA2050T34-FSW was examined as a function of post weld heat treatment condition. Immersion tests in 0.1 M Nac1 and G110 intergranular tests were performed and the corrsion morphology and the depth of attacks in the different regions of the weld were investigated using FEG/SEM. Polarisation measuresments in the different regions of the weld and long term OCP for the full weld were taken and results were correlated with immersion test observations.
